Output 66abf8ea9ce7f1f4229f907a628771d1e609c9ae758b90dcc825159a515c774a:1

value
240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 139a607ff075fb97c0dbb0157da90bafeb7b04d8 OP_EQUAL
address
33UfhVDFByxrRRJUYFg3UKu8NjFVEQ7Rqn
transaction
66abf8ea9ce7f1f4229f907a628771d1e609c9ae758b90dcc825159a515c774a
spent
true